Summary
The study aims to assess the effect of the use of neuroprotection in transcutaneous occlusion of the left atrial appendage in patients with atrial fibrillation on the risk of perioperative silent brain ischemia and associated cognitive impairment and depression.

Interventions
After aortography the cerebral protection system will be delivered to cerebral arteries through radial access before accessing the left atrium.
Only the aortography through radial access will be done before accessing the left atrium.
